Why not drill two holes of a suitable size about 120 degree angle
opposite one another and drive two wooden pegs into them, forming a
cleat configuration? Situate the cleat so the tension comes from the
side, and you are in business. You could even prep the pegs with
preservative if you're worried about rotting. I usually just find a
suitable branch and secure to that, but maybe your trees have no low
branches.

All wood solution, no future risk of a chainsaw mishap.
